For microbiology laboratories, clinical diagnostic facilities, and biomedical research institutions, preparing enrichment media for the cultivation of fastidious and demanding microorganisms requires high-quality, consistent blood products free from fibrin clots. The global Defibrinated Horse Blood market addresses this need through mechanically defibrinated, sterile horse blood that provides reliable performance for microbiology diagnostics and research. As infectious disease testing and bacteriology workflows expand globally, demand for defibrinated horse blood continues to grow steadily.
The global market for Defibrinated Horse Blood was estimated to be worth US$ 89.91 million in 2025 and is projected to reach US$ 143 million, growing at a CAGR of 6.9% from 2026 to 2032. In 2024, global production reached 672.019 kiloliters, with an average selling price of US$ 135.16 per liter. This steady growth reflects consistent demand from clinical diagnostics and pharmaceutical quality control laboratories.

Essential Blood Product for Microbiology Culture Media
Defibrinated horse blood is a high-quality, sterile blood product designed for microbiology laboratories. It is essential for preparing enrichment media, particularly for the cultivation of a wide range of demanding microorganisms. Mechanically defibrated, this blood remains free of fibrin clots, providing consistent performance in microbiology diagnostics and research.
The defibrination process removes fibrin through mechanical agitation, preventing clot formation and ensuring uniform distribution of blood components in culture media. Horse blood is preferred for certain applications due to its large red blood cells and specific growth factor composition that supports fastidious organisms. Common applications include preparation of blood agar plates, chocolate agar, and specialized enrichment broths for pathogens such as Streptococcus, Haemophilus, and Neisseria species.

Technology Developments & Quality Standards
Over the past six months, several developments have shaped the market. Improved collection and processing protocols have enhanced batch-to-batch consistency for large-volume users. Extended shelf-life formulations (up to 2 years) have reduced waste for lower-volume laboratories. Sterility testing and quality control documentation have become more stringent, with suppliers providing certificates of analysis for each lot.
The trend toward laboratory consolidation and centralized microbiology services has increased demand for larger packaging sizes and consistent supply. Regulatory requirements for culture media quality control (CLSI, ISO standards) drive demand for validated blood products. Animal welfare and sourcing transparency have become considerations for some institutional purchasers.
